(addition throughout the news)Software company Vidhance reports lower revenue and a worsened EBITDA result in the second quarter compared with the same period a year earlier."We are seeing positive developments, but an individual quarter should always be viewed with caution. We are not yet where we want to be, but the quarter shows that our efforts are beginning to bear fruit, not least through the first contribution from Defence and Vision Systems. We operate in a volatile market, characterised by macroeconomic factors and business cycles that place high demands on perseverance and focus," says CEO Johan Bolin.Revenue fell to SEK 4.0 million (5.3). Revenue increased slightly compared with the previous quarter.EBITDA was -SEK 5.3 million (-4.0).Profit after net financial items amounted to -SEK 5.4 million (-5.7), and net profit was -SEK 5.4 million (-5.7).Earnings per share amounted to -SEK 1.19 (-1.24).Operating expenses decreased to SEK 9.6 million (12.2). Cash flow after investing activities was -SEK 6.3 million (-6.2)."The quarter was also burdened by one-off costs. These include administrative and legal costs related to supporting the customer that has been involved in a patent dispute in the US. As previously communicated, we have not had any other costs related to the dispute. In addition, we have implemented cost-saving measures that weigh on results in the short term but strengthen our cost structure and profitability going forward. We are entering the third quarter with a significantly lower cost base than a year ago," the CEO says.He adds: "Overall, the quarter shows several encouraging signs, and we retain a humble and realistic view of the path ahead".
